If there‘s one key take-away from this project, it is that for product shots using depth and establishing a scene that makes sense physically goes a long way. Composition-wise it helps to have a foreground element, the middle ground with the product and also a background.
Although this might seem so simple and obvious sometimes I have to recall these basic rules in order to get a good result faster. Just pushing shapes around, without a plan or concept just takes too much time.
Another thing is: Don‘t stop pushing your creativity when you get something good for the first time. The first set of images I presented to was using this color scheme but looked flat compared to the end result. After their feedback, I went back and took a closer look at reference images. How other people composed product shots and what I was missing about it. So I got into the project files again and applied the principles I could uncover there.
I think that is something talks about a lot in his more practical design videos. The importance of breaking down other images to why they work, and how you can apply these techniques to your own.

For this shot I used strong rimlights to contour the object and hight its shape. While setting light in Blender it almost felt like I was drawing with light. It's easy to control the areas of contrast, hence leading the eye to the most interesting parts of the object.
That was a somewhat fascinating process to go through.

Also for this shot I think the Color Grading in was really important and added that clean finish.
